MEOW is currently trading at $10 per share, but you want to receive at least $12 per share. You would set your limit price to $12. If MEOW rises from $10 to $12 or higher, and there are buyers available, your order should be filled (partially or fully) at your limit price or higher.

A stop order is an order to buy or sell crypto once it reaches a specific price, known as the stop price.. When a coin reaches your set stop price, the stop order becomes a crypto market order and is executed at the best ask or bid price currently available, with up to a 1% collar for buy orders or a 5% collar for sell orders. A stop order is an order to buy or sell a stock or ETF once the stock reaches a specific price, known as the stop price.. When the stock hits your stop price, the stop order becomes a market order and is executed at the best price currently available.
